Sidee loo doortaa, loo isticmaalaa oo loo dayactiraa doon PECVD ah?

 

1. Waa maxay doon PECVD ah?

 

1.1 Qeexidda iyo hawlaha asaasiga ah

Doonta PECVD (Plasma Enhanced Chemical Vapor Deposition) waa qalab asaasi ah oo loo isticmaalo in lagu qaado wafers ama substrate-ka habka PECVD. Waxay u baahan tahay inay si joogto ah ugu shaqeyso jawi heerkul sare (300-600°C), gaas plasma-ku-shaqeysiiya iyo gaas daxalaysan (sida SiH₄, NH₃). Shaqooyinkeeda ugu muhiimsan waxaa ka mid ah:

● Meelaynta saxda ah: hubi kala fogaanshaha wafer-ka oo isku mid ah oo iska ilaali faragelinta dahaarka.
● Xakamaynta goobta kulaylka: hagaaji qaybinta heerkulka oo hagaaji isku mid ahaanshaha filimka.
● Caqabadda ka hortagga wasakhowga: Waxay ka soocdaa balaasmaha godka qalabka si loo yareeyo khatarta wasakhowga birta.

1.2 Qaab-dhismeedka caadiga ah iyo agabka

Xulashada agabka:

● Doonta Graphite (doorashada caadiga ah): kuleyl badan oo la qaadi karo, iska caabin heerkul sare leh, kharash yar, laakiin waxay u baahan tahay dahaar si looga hortago miridhku.
Doon Quartz ah: Nadiifnimo aad u sarreysa, kiimiko ahaan u adkaysta, laakiin aad u jaban oo qaali ah.
Dhoobada (sida Al₂O₃): Waxay u adkaystaa xirashada, waxayna ku habboon tahay wax soo saarka soo noqnoqda badan, laakiin waxay u adkaysataa kulaylka.

Astaamaha ugu muhiimsan ee naqshadaynta:

● Kala fogaanshaha booska: Dhumucda wafer-ka isku midka ah (sida dulqaadka 0.3-1mm).
Naqshadeynta godka socodka hawada: hagaaji qaybinta gaaska falcelinta iyo yaraynta saameynta geeska.
Dahaarka dusha sare: Dahaarka Caadiga ah ee SiC, TaC ama DLC (kaarboon u eg dheeman) si loo dheereeyo cimriga adeegga.

2. Maxaan fiiro gaar ah u siineynaa waxqabadka doomaha PECVD?

 

2.1 Afar arrimood oo waaweyn oo si toos ah u saameeya wax-soo-saarka geeddi-socodka

 

✔ Xakamaynta Wasakhowga:
Wasakhda ku jirta jirka doonta (sida Fe iyo Na) way qallalaan heerkul sare, taasoo keenta godad ama daadasho filimka.
Diirka dahaarka ayaa keeni doona walxo waxayna sababi doonaan cillado dahaarka ah (tusaale ahaan, walxaha ka badan 0.3μm waxay sababi karaan in hufnaanta batteriga ay hoos u dhacdo 0.5%).

✔ Isku mid ahaanshaha goobta kulaylka:
Kuleylka aan sinnayn ee doonida garaafka PECVD waxay horseedi doontaa kala duwanaansho dhumucda filimka (tusaale ahaan, shuruudaha isku midka ah ee ±5%, farqiga heerkulka waa inuu ka yar yahay 10°C).

✔ Waafaqsanaanta Plasma:
Alaabada aan habboonayn waxay sababi karaan dheecaan aan caadi ahayn waxayna dhaawici karaan wafer-ka ama elektroodhada qalabka.

✔ Cimriga adeegga iyo kharashka:
Qolalka doonyaha ee tayada hooseeya waxay u baahan yihiin in si joogto ah loo beddelo (tusaale ahaan bishiiba mar), kharashyada dayactirka sanadlaha ahna waa qaali.

3. Sidee loo doortaa, loo isticmaalaa oo loo ilaaliyaa doon PECVD ah?

 

3.1 Habka xulashada saddexda tallaabo

 

Tallaabada 1: Caddee xuduudaha habka

● Heerkulka kala duwan: Dahaarka Graphite + SiC waxaa laga dooran karaa meel ka hooseysa 450°C, quartz ama dhoobadana waxaa loo baahan yahay meel ka sarreysa 600°C.
Nooca Gaaska: Marka ay ku jiraan gaasaska sunta ah sida Cl2 iyo F-, waa in la isticmaalaa dahaadh cufnaan sare leh.
Cabbirka Wafer: Xoogga qaab-dhismeedka doonida ee 8-inch/12-inch aad ayuu uga duwan yahay wuxuuna u baahan yahay naqshad bartilmaameedsan.

Tallaabada 2: Qiimee halbeegyada waxqabadka

Halbeegyada Muhiimka ah:

Qalafsanaanta dusha sare (Ra): ≤0.8μm (dusha taabashada waa inay ahaataa ≤0.4μm)
Xoogga xidhmada dahaarka: ≥15MPa (ASTM C633 standard)
Isbeddelka heerkulka sare (600℃): ≤0.1mm/m (tijaabo 24 saacadood ah)

Tallaabada 3: Xaqiiji iswaafajinta

● Iswaafajinta qalabka: Xaqiiji cabbirka is-dhexgalka iyadoo la adeegsanayo moodooyinka caadiga ah sida AMAT Centura, centrotherm PECVD, iwm.
● Tijaabada wax soo saarka tijaabada ah: Waxaa lagu talinayaa in la sameeyo tijaabo dufcad yar oo ah 50-100 xabbo si loo xaqiijiyo isku mid ahaanshaha dahaarka (kala duwanaanshaha caadiga ah ee dhumucda filimka <3%).

3.2 Hababka ugu Fiican ee Isticmaalka iyo Dayactirka

 

Tilmaamaha Hawlgalka:

Habka nadiifinta kahor:

● Kahor isticmaalka ugu horreeya, Xinzhou wuxuu u baahan yahay in lagu shubo balaasmaha Ar muddo 30 daqiiqo ah si looga saaro wasakhda ku nuugta dusha sare.

Ka dib dufcad kasta oo hab-raac ah, SC1 (NH₄OH:H₂O₂:H₂O=1:1:5) ayaa loo isticmaalaa nadiifinta si looga saaro haraaga dabiiciga ah.

✔ Soo rarista waxyaabaha mamnuuca ah:

Rarka xad-dhaafka ah waa mamnuuc (tusaale ahaan, awoodda ugu badan waxaa loogu talagalay inay noqoto 50 xabbo, laakiin culayska dhabta ah waa inuu ahaadaa ≤ 45 xabbo si loo helo meel bannaan oo lagu ballaarin karo).

Cidhifka waferku waa inuu ka fogaadaa ≥2mm dhammaadka haanta doonta si looga hortago saamaynta cidhifka balaasmaha.

✔ Talooyin ku saabsan Kordhinta Nolosha

● Dayactirka dahaarka: Marka dusha sare ee qalafsanaantu tahay Ra>1.2μm, dahaarka SiC waxaa dib u dhigi kara CVD (qiimuhu waa 40% ka hooseeya beddelka).

✔ Baaritaan joogto ah:

● Bishiiba: Hubi daacadnimada dahaarka adoo isticmaalaya interferometry iftiin cad.
Saddexdii biloodba mar: Falanqee heerka kiristaalka ee doonida iyada oo loo marayo XRD (doonta quartz wafer oo leh wejiga kiristaalka > 5% ayaa loo baahan yahay in la beddelo).

4. Waa maxay dhibaatooyinka caadiga ah?

 

S1: Ma sameyn karaaDoonta PECVDloo isticmaali karaa habka LPCVD?

J: Laguma talinayo! LPCVD waxay leedahay heerkul sare (badanaa 800-1100°C) waxayna u baahan tahay inay u adkaysato cadaadiska gaaska oo sarreeya. Waxay u baahan tahay isticmaalka agab u adkaysta isbeddellada heerkulka (sida isostatic graphite), naqshadda booskana waxay u baahan tahay inay tixgeliso magdhowga ballaarinta kulaylka.
S2: Sidee loo go'aamiyaa in meydka doontu uu fashilmay iyo in kale?

J: Jooji isticmaalka isla markiiba haddii calaamadaha soo socda ay soo baxaan:
Dildilaaca ama diirka dahaarka ayaa isha qaawan laga arki karaa.
Kala beddelka caadiga ah ee isku-dhafka dahaarka wafer wuxuu ahaa >5% saddex dufcadood oo isku xiga.
Heerka faaruqnimada ee qolka hawsha ayaa hoos u dhacay in ka badan 10%.
